While Dipset puts the finishing touches on their reunion album, founding member Jim Jones will release his fifth studio album, Capo, on April 5.
According to Jones, roughly 60 songs were recorded for LP. Over the next few weeks, the Harlemite will complete the arduous process of narrowing down songs for an official tracklist. To date, two songs have been released for the project: “Blow Your Smoke” featuring Rell, and the official first single “Perfect Day.”
Capo will feature appearances from Raekwon, Snoop Dogg, Roscoe Dash, Cam’Ron, Juelz Santana and Vado.
At press time, Jones is confirmed to be a part of VH1’s eight-part documentary/soap series Love & Hip-Hop. The show airs March 14.
